The Ormsgate Theatre seat-map renderer previously read venue layouts from flat JSON files. In this step, move layouts into the `venue_layouts` table, preserving row labels and accessibility flags exactly — downstream pricing depends on them. Run the importer once per venue, verify seat counts against the legacy files, and only then flip the `USE_DB_LAYOUTS` flag. Keep the JSON files until two full show cycles complete without discrepancies. The importer and renderer both read from the layouts database via the connection string below.

replica DSN, fawif-fahaf: clickhouse://ralvan_svc:hJSsNCc@db-e396.plorvadata.corp:5432/holius

## Break-glass: Proctorly exam queue

Quick notes for the sync. If the proctoring queue jams mid-exam (it happened twice last term), normal deploys are too slow — use break-glass. That gives you direct write access to the queue broker so you can drain stuck sessions. Use it sparingly; every invocation gets audited and Marisol reviews the log weekly. To actually trigger break-glass, the broker console asks for the recovery passphrase shown just below.

vault phrase of bagaf-kajeg = jorath-feniel-briir-siliel-ralix

Subject: Quickstore 4.2 — bloom filter now fronts the KV layer

Plugin authors: starting with this release, Quickstore places a bloom filter ahead of the key-value store. Negative lookups return faster; false positives fall through safely. No API changes are required on your side. Verify your plugin against the staging build referenced below.

session token of fahif-tadup = htk3_9c7

Internal Memo — Customer Concentration at Tolveren Fabrics

Team — quick heads-up. Our top account, Quillmark Retail, now represents 44% of revenue, up from 31% last year. That's great for the quarter, less great for our sleep. If Quillmark sneezes, we catch the flu. We're not asking anyone to slow-walk their orders, but we do need the pipeline broadened: each sales lead should bring two qualified mid-tier prospects to the March review. Leadership has already agreed how we'll rebalance, and the essentials are captured in the note that follows.

internal memo for yajop-tahog: Fradorox Group plans to raise the Fravan list price by 8.6 percent in June. The pricing group signed off on a budget of $133.1 million for Project Pelmir. The renewal with Caswynek Partners closes at $416.4 million a year, 19.7 percent below the last contract. Project Norael slips by six weeks because of the supplier delay.